Have you logged out and back in again after trying this I think you need to do that for lxseisson defualt changes to take effect. I think for that to take effect to get the browser button on panel you have to click the set debian default program under the more button. The browser quick launch icon in the panel basically runs the command x-www-browser which is set by setting the debian default. Thing is on most 768 pixel high screens most of the other buttons for set debian defualt is off the bottom of the screen by bug but not for the browser supsringly. Although the debian defualt unfortanetly is system wide.
